Chapter 587 384: Shadows
Just at that moment, a maid suddenly raced over from the other end of the corridor. Seeing many people in the garden, she whispered something to Guan Kui.
Guan Kui's expression changed, and he immediately grabbed a lantern and ran towards the other end of the corridor.
Tang Wanhong watched Guan Kui and the maid's hastily departing figures. With narrowed eyes, he already guessed what happened.
He glared at the guards still gathered in the garden and yelled coldly, "What are you all standing around for? Guard your posts and get back to your duties!"
The guards, sensing Tang Wanhong's implicit anger, immediately dispersed, concealing themselves in the dark.
The man with the felt hat also intended to leave, but Tang Wanhong suddenly called him, "Xiong Yi, don't go. Wait for me in my room. I'll be over shortly."
After all, the person who sneaked into Shen Garden tonight had fought with Xiong Yi. He had to find out the situation clearly.
"Yes, Mr. Tang," Xiong Yi replied in a low voice and turned to walk towards Tang Wanhong's room.
After instructing Xiong Yi, Tang Wanhong quickly walked towards the other end of the corridor, a bit worried that Guan Kui might not handle things well.
Sure enough, just as he reached the end of the corridor, Guan Kui burst out carrying a lantern. He saw Tang Wanhong walking quickly and hesitated for a moment, then said, "Shopkeeper, the two County Magistrates are clamoring to leave."
Tang Wanhong's face hardened. "You handle your part. Pack up the room as needed."
Guan Kui stepped aside, slightly bowed his head, and said, "Yes."
Tang Wanhong hurried past Guan Kui and pushed open the door to a nearby room.
As he entered, his initially hard face was immediately filled with a reserved smile.
Inside the room, the two County Magistrates were already dressed, one sitting at the table drinking water continuously, the other pacing back and forth near the table.
Both had expressions that were somewhat flustered.
The moment Tang Wanhong entered, the gaze of the two immediately locked onto him.
The man pacing stopped and looked at him, saying, "Mr. Tang, what happened just now? Didn't you say this place was very safe?"
The man sipping tea at the table spat out a piece of tea leaf. "Yes! Who broke in just now? Have we been exposed?"
Tang Wanhong smiled and said, "Both of you, please calm down. It was just a petty thief, frightened away by the guards. No need to panic."
"Frightened away?"
The two County Magistrates exchanged a glance, then the one standing by the table turned to ask, "Wasn't he captured?"
Tang Wanhong said, "No, he wasn't captured."
"Mr. Tang, quick! Arrange for someone to send us away!"
Tang Wanhong said, "Yes, I'll arrange it immediately."
Tang Wanhong also thought it best to send these two away as soon as possible, so he could focus on investigating tonight's incident. He had an uneasy feeling; tonight's affair was far from simple.
Duan Rong, carrying that long wooden box containing the "Autumn Clearing," walked alone along the dark path back to the room they had previously dined in.
He slowly stepped into the room.
Inside, Shen Mizi had already returned and was chatting idly with Xiao Yu at the dining table.
She had already changed out of her night clothes and back into her original green water skirt.
Duan Rong glanced at Shen Mizi and then sat down at the dining table, without revealing any emotion.
Duan Rong noticed that the sweat on Shen Mizi's forehead had just been wiped, bright and shiny. Moreover, there was a small piece of lingering fine sweat on her right temple, evidently missed due to haste.
As Duan Rong looked over, Shen Mizi's eyes clearly averted.
Xiao Yu turned to Duan Rong and said, "Why did it take you so long?"
Duan Rong replied, "I had a few words with an old friend."
As he spoke, he handed the long wooden box to Xiao Yu, saying, "Keep this safe."
Xiao Yu accepted it and asked, "What is it?"
"A painting," Duan Rong said, "Keep it well, it might come in handy later."
"Is that so?" Xiao Yu only thought Duan Rong was speaking casually and placed the box behind her indifferently.
After Duan Rong returned, she placed a plate of stir-fried beef in front of him and said, "You didn't eat much earlier. This beef is good, have some more."
Duan Rong nodded and picked up a few slices of beef, putting them in his mouth. Indeed, it was delicious, very flavorful. Should have been braised before stir-frying.
While Duan Rong was eating, Shen Mizi and Xiao Yu resumed their idle chat.
Though Shen Mizi smiled faintly, Duan Rong could see the shadow and deeply hidden resentment from her smile.
Shen Mizi was actually a tragedy.
Duan Rong remembered a term he often heard in his previous life, called "original family."
On the surface, her life seemed more privileged than Xiao Yu's.
However, the father-daughter relationship between Xiao Yu and Xiao Zongting was good. In their hearts, they highly recognized each other's existence.
This made them true family, a bond closely connecting them, allowing Xiao Yu to truly experience warmth and happiness.
This experience filled her life, giving her an inner vitality.
But Shen Mizi was the opposite. Although Shen Yanliu was already honored as Inspector General, Shen Mizi grew up in a lonely environment.
Emotionally, she didn't recognize her father.
It's like a thorn in her heart, based on a paranoid, cold life experience, making it difficult for her to recognize the world.
In the Inner Garden, Tang Wanhong's room.
The two were already seated, Xiong Yi seemed a bit uneasy.
The bright lights in the room illuminated Xiong Yi's face, with deep-set eyes and a straight nose.
